Smallest German Shorthaired Pointer. Smaller gsps do exist and are sometimes called “pocket pointers,” but they aren’t a separate or rare breed. Keep reading as i discuss the common traits of gsps and how to get a “miniature” gsp. Beyond the most common reasons to want a miniature gsp, it’s worth noting that a smaller german shorthaired pointer is actually a great hunter as well with improved versatility above a traditional sized gsp. A german shorthaired pointer may be small when both its parents are small. The german shorthaired pointer (gsp or shorthair for short) is an active bird dog. They are attentive, affectionate, and biddable, with energy to burn. Athletic, smart, and friendly—sounds like a recipe for popularity, doesn’t it? Male german shorthaired pointers stand between 23 and 25 inches at the shoulder and weigh anywhere from 55 to 70 pounds;
